Overview

This is a preliminary design for the PTP Resource Management system. This is the design of the first phase product, which is limited in scope to viewing the state of the resource manager. This includes the machines, jobs, queues, and nodes that are under the resource manager's control. The classes currently in PTP will implement these new interfaces in addition to their previously implemented interfaces.

File:Ptp resource manager view.pdf

Package resourcemanager

For interfaces and abstract classes, the responsibilities and collaborations refer to concrete objects that are implementations of the interface or abstract class.

Interface: IRMResourceManager

Responsibilities
Proxy used to connect to the ResourceManagerHost's actual resource manager (ARM).
Retrieve list of machines, nodes, jobs, process, and queues from ARM.
Notify registered objects that the lists have changed, either in composition, or in their element's attributes due to changes propagated from the ARM
Collaborations
IRMResourceManagerHost
IRMResourceManagerListener
RMResourceManagerEvent
RMNodesChangedEvent
RMJobsChangedEvent
RMQueuesChangedEvent
RMStructureChangedEvent
IRMMachine, IRMNode, IRMJob, IRMQueue

Interface: IRMResourceManagerListener

Responsibilities
Registration site for Observer pattern to allow objects to be notified of changes in the IRMResourceManager's status
Collaborations
IRMResourceManager
IRMEvent

Interface: ResourceManagerEvent

Responsibilities
Determine type of changed in the IRMResourceManager's state
Collaborations
none

Class: ResourceManagerHost

Responsibilities
Determine which remote (or local) host's resource manager to proxy
Determine which resource manager on the host to proxy
Provide hosts's status
Collaborations
RMStatus

Interface: IRMMachine

Responsibilities
Provide the status information, i.e. attributes, for the ARM's associated machine
Set and provide specific attributes for a given attribute description
List all nodes associated with ARM's machine
Provide machine's status
Collaborations
IAttribute
IAttrDesc
RMStatus

Interface: IRMQueue

Responsibilities
Provide the status information, i.e. attributes, for the ARM's associated queue
Set and provide specific attributes for a given attribute description
List all nodes that may have jobs dispatched from this queue
Provide queue's status
Collaborations
IAttribute
IAttrDesc
RMStatus

Interface: IRMNode

Responsibilities
Provide the status information, i.e. attributes, for the ARM's associated node
Set and provide specific attributes for a given attribute description
List all jobs associated with ARM's node
List all queues that can run jobs on this node
Provide node's status
Collaborations
IAttribute
IAttrDesc
RMStatus

Interface: IRMJob

Responsibilities
Provide the status information, i.e. attributes, for the ARM's associated job
Set and provide specific attributes for a given attribute description
List all processes associated with ARM's job
Provide job's status
Collaborations
IAttribute
IAttrDesc
RMJobStatus

Interface: IRMProcess

Responsibilities
Provide the status information, i.e. attributes, for the ARM's associated process
Set and provide specific attributes for a given attribute description
Provide node on which the process runs
Collaborations
IAttribute
IAttrDesc

Interface: IAttribute

Responsibilities
Maintain the relationship between an attribute's value and its description
Specifies a strict-weak ordering of itself and other attributes
Provide a string representation of the attribute
Collaborations
IAttrDesc

Interface: IAttrDesc

Responsibilities
Provide a string description of the attribute
Provide a name of the attribute
Know the actual type of the attribute
Create new attributes of the correct type
Collaborations
IAttribute

Enumeration: RMStatus

Responsibilities
Provide consistent labeling of element status
OK element is up and able to accept jobs, etc.
DOWN element is down, reason will have to be provided in other attributes
UNAVAILABLE element is unable to accept jobs, etc., reason will have to be provied in other attributes
Collaborations
ResourceManagerHost, IRMMachine, IRMNode, IRMQueue

Enumeration: RMJobStatus

Responsibilities
Provide consistent labeling of job status
PENDING job is pending in queue
RUNNING job is running normally
SUSPENDED job is suspended, reason will have to be provided in other attributes
DONE job has completed normally
EXIT job has completed abnormally, reason will have to be provide in other attributes
UNKNOWN job status is unknown
Collaborations
IRMJob
